Output 5086d59ff4c667abd6838e9b7df019282f676b1d9a23130a44b3616c9a937311:45

value
548986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92aea7ab8b474e144af77111272d4536a99d9d3 OP_EQUAL
address
3MVHy2Fc7ExLKRZenDJRqPbHe8vbW4Y1yi
transaction
5086d59ff4c667abd6838e9b7df019282f676b1d9a23130a44b3616c9a937311
spent
true